Available Now! Having recently undergone a scheme of refurbishment, this detached three-bedroom home is ready to move straight into and offers spacious accommodation both inside and out. The accommodation briefly comprises a side entrance lobby leading into a generous front living room, together with a well-appointed dining kitchen which opens into an extended dining area, creating a versatile space for everyday family life and entertaining. A rear lobby provides access to the garden, while the ground floor also benefits from a bathroom featuring both a separate bath and shower, wash hand basin, and a separate WC. To the first floor are three well-proportioned bedrooms, providing flexible accommodation for families, couples or those working from home. Externally, the property enjoys a block paved front with side driveway providing off-road parking, a detached garage and rear garden with artificial lawn, patio seating areas and a pleasant woodland outlook beyond, creating an attractive outdoor space to enjoy throughout the year. Situated in a popular and well-established residential area of Horbury, the property is within easy reach of Horbury town centre, where you'll find a variety of shops, supermarkets, cafés, restaurants and everyday amenities. The area is well served by highly regarded schools and offers excellent transport links to Wakefield city centre, Junctions 39 and 40 of the M1 motorway, and surrounding towns. Nearby parks, countryside walks and the Calder & Hebble Navigation provide further opportunities for outdoor recreation.
